Ephraim Mcdowell Regional Medical C Enter is a 501(c)(3) organization based in Danville, Kentucky, registered in 1972, with $282,057,394 in FY2023 revenue. CharityIndex grades it A, and it directs about 81% of spending to programs.

Measures how much of every dollar spent actually reaches programs, plus what it costs to raise $100 of donations. The worse of the two measures sets the letter (85%+ to programs is an A; under $15 to raise $100 is an A), averaged over the three most recent filings. For Ephraim Mcdowell Regional Medical C Enter: 81% to programs · $0 to raise $100 earns a A on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
Measures whether the organization is built to last: how many months its reserves would cover expenses (3+ months earns an A-range score, but hoarding 5+ years of budget is capped) and whether it runs a surplus or a deficit. For Ephraim Mcdowell Regional Medical C Enter: 13 mo reserves · +3% margin earns a A on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
Checks how the organization is run, from its own Form 990: an independent board majority, a board of five or more, conflict-of-interest, whistleblower and document-retention policies, and independently audited financials. The share of disclosed checks that pass sets the letter. For Ephraim Mcdowell Regional Medical C Enter: 6 of 6 checks met earns a A+ on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
Counts five disclosure signals: a recent filing, a mission statement, program descriptions, a listed website, and the full expense breakdown. More disclosure, better letter. For Ephraim Mcdowell Regional Medical C Enter: 4 of 5 disclosure signals earns a A on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→

The organization's primary mission is to be the leading provider of quality health care services in the central kentucky communities we serve.
Revenue grew from $167.3M (FY2013) to $282.1M (FY2023) across 11 reported years.
